FIELD: chemistry.
SUBSTANCE: invention relates to insecticides. An anti-moth agent in spray form contains transfluthrin, neonol and phenoxyethanol as solvents, and water as a base, with the following ratio of components (wt %): transfluthrin - 0.2-0.6; neonol 9.10 -0.5-3.0; phenoxyethanol - 0.5-3.0; odorant - 0.05-0.1; water - the balance.
EFFECT: invention increases efficiency of the agent.
